Mogadishu, Somalia (Horn Observer) A passenger plane carrying more than 30 passengers crash landed at Mogadishu's Adan Abdulle International Airport on Monday officials said.


The plane Fokker 50 was carrying 33 passengers flew from Baidoa when it crash landed. Somali officials said that all passengers on board including crews have been rescued.


The plane was reportedly owned by Jubba Airways, a Somali airline compnay.

The airport which was shutdown for couple hours was later reopened, according to a statement by the Somali civil aviation authority.
